1. Paul Henry Thornapple Trail
SCENIC OUTDOOR PATHWAY
Paul Henry Thornapple Trail offers visitors a beautiful 42-mile multi-use path following the old Grand River Valley Railroad route. Out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y biking, hiking, and running while exploring the natural beauty of the Kentwood area. The well-maintained trail features bridges, scenic views, and connects to various parks and recreational areas throughout the region.

7. LEGO Store
BRICK-BUILDING WONDERLAND
The LEGO Store at Woodland Mall delights visitors with nearly 3,000 square feet of brick-building possibilities in Kentwood. Featuring popular elements like Build-a-Mini-figure stations and the Pick & Build Wall, this store offers hard-to-find sets and creative experiences. LEGO enthusiasts of all ages can explore their creativity and add to their collections in this specialized retail environment.
8. Millennium Park
VAST URBAN RECREATION AREA
Millennium Park stands as the largest urban park in West Michigan, spanning 1,500 acres of beautifully reclaimed land near Kentwood. Visitors can relax on the beach, rent boats, or explore miles of trails while enjoying the lush landscape teeming with wildlife. The park's diverse recreational opportunities make it a perfect destination for nature enthusiasts and families seeking outdoor activities.
